Subject: DR drill covering consent banner rollout

Hi — as release manager, please note next Tuesday's disaster-recovery drill at Gullwharf will include the Lanternleaf consent banner. We'll simulate a region loss mid-rollout and confirm the banner config replicates cleanly, with no consent records dropped. Hold the phase-two release until the drill report is signed off. To restore the rollout controller during the exercise, enter the passphrase below.

strongbox words: gilok-druion-briath-wendor-briion-prawyn-fenion-oliir-casdor-holius-briius-gilath-gilael-pelys

# Basement Archive Room — Night Access

The archive room under Pellworth House holds old contracts and the tape backups. Night shift: take stairwell C, not the lift (it's switched off after midnight). Lights are on a timer by the door — slap the button as you go in. Sign the logbook, even at 3am, yes really. The keypad by the door takes the code below.

staff pass of fahap-tajeg = bdg-FT-6

Runbook: FuelTrak report account recovery. If the scheduled fleet fuel-usage report fails with an auth error, the FuelTrak service account is locked. Do not create a new account. Open the Kestrel admin console, find the service account under Reporting, and select Recover. Verify the last successful report timestamp matches the dispatch log before proceeding. Recovery prompts for the team passphrase. Contractors: confirm with the shift lead first. The passphrase is recorded directly below this line.

unlock words, yahag-fahag: julmir-wenys-gilys-casion-quenmir

**Q: Why does Pinwheel keep failing DNS lookups?**

Short version: the Skerry resolver pool drops queries under load, so Pinwheel's service discovery flakes roughly once a day. Retries mask most of it, but batch jobs still trip. Workaround for now: bump the resolver timeout to 3s. If you're seeing it more often than that, flag it to the infra rotation.

pager mailbox: druwyn@norvaio.corp